Source file "com/icl/saxon/aelfred/XmlParser.java" was not found during generation of report.
| Element | Missed Instructions | Cov. | Missed Branches | Cov. | Missed | Cxty | Missed | Lines | Missed | Methods |
| Total | 6,207 of 6,207 | 0% | 905 of 905 | 0% | 588 | 588 | 1,486 | 1,486 | 118 | 118 |
| pushURL(String, String, String, Reader, InputStream, String, boolean) | 0% | 0% | 27 | 27 | 94 | 94 | 1 | 1 | ||
| readNmtoken(boolean) | 0% | 0% | 28 | 28 | 32 | 32 | 1 | 1 | ||
| readLiteral(int) | 0% | 0% | 21 | 21 | 48 | 48 | 1 | 1 | ||
| readDataChunk() | 0% | 0% | 21 | 21 | 47 | 47 | 1 | 1 | ||
| copyUtf8ReadBuffer(int) | 0% | 0% | 9 | 9 | 31 | 31 | 1 | 1 | ||
| detectEncoding() | 0% | 0% | 11 | 11 | 32 | 32 | 1 | 1 | ||
| setupDecoding(String) | 0% | 0% | 26 | 26 | 32 | 32 | 1 | 1 | ||
| parseCharRef() | 0% | 0% | 17 | 17 | 29 | 29 | 1 | 1 | ||
| popInput() | 0% | 0% | 9 | 9 | 29 | 29 | 1 | 1 | ||
| doParse(String, String, Reader, InputStream, String) | 0% | 0% | 10 | 10 | 31 | 31 | 1 | 1 | ||
| parseCharData() | 0% | 0% | 16 | 16 | 39 | 39 | 1 | 1 | ||
| parseElement() | 0% | 0% | 11 | 11 | 36 | 36 | 1 | 1 | ||
| pushInput(String) | 0% | 0% | 5 | 5 | 24 | 24 | 1 | 1 | ||
| copyUcs4ReadBuffer(int, int, int, int, int) | 0% | 0% | 7 | 7 | 16 | 16 | 1 | 1 | ||
| intern(char[], int, int) | 0% | 0% | 9 | 9 | 24 | 24 | 1 | 1 | ||
| parseEntityDecl() | 0% | 0% | 9 | 9 | 30 | 30 | 1 | 1 | ||
| readExternalIds(boolean) | 0% | 0% | 12 | 12 | 26 | 26 | 1 | 1 | ||
| parseDoctypedecl() | 0% | 0% | 5 | 5 | 32 | 32 | 1 | 1 | ||
| readCh() | 0% | 0% | 15 | 15 | 24 | 24 | 1 | 1 | ||
| copyUcs2ReadBuffer(int, int, int) | 0% | 0% | 8 | 8 | 18 | 18 | 1 | 1 | ||
| parseAttribute(String) | 0% | 0% | 6 | 6 | 18 | 18 | 1 | 1 | ||
| initializeVariables() | 0% | n/a | 1 | 1 | 25 | 25 | 1 | 1 | ||
| parseXMLDecl(boolean) | 0% | 0% | 10 | 10 | 28 | 28 | 1 | 1 | ||
| dataBufferNormalize() | 0% | 0% | 9 | 9 | 16 | 16 | 1 | 1 | ||
| static {...} | 0% | n/a | 1 | 1 | 13 | 13 | 1 | 1 | ||
| parseElements() | 0% | 0% | 7 | 7 | 35 | 35 | 1 | 1 | ||
| parseContent() | 0% | 0% | 9 | 9 | 33 | 33 | 1 | 1 | ||
| require(String, String) | 0% | 0% | 6 | 6 | 14 | 14 | 1 | 1 | ||
| parsePEReference() | 0% | 0% | 7 | 7 | 14 | 14 | 1 | 1 | ||
| filterCR(boolean) | 0% | 0% | 6 | 6 | 16 | 16 | 1 | 1 | ||
| getAttributeExpandedValue(String, String) | 0% | 0% | 6 | 6 | 15 | 15 | 1 | 1 | ||
| parseConditionalSect() | 0% | 0% | 9 | 9 | 23 | 23 | 1 | 1 | ||
| dataBufferFlush() | 0% | 0% | 8 | 8 | 12 | 12 | 1 | 1 | ||
| skipWhitespace() | 0% | 0% | 8 | 8 | 22 | 22 | 1 | 1 | ||
| parseMarkupdecl() | 0% | 0% | 9 | 9 | 18 | 18 | 1 | 1 | ||
| parseEntityRef(boolean) | 0% | 0% | 7 | 7 | 15 | 15 | 1 | 1 | ||
| setElement(String, int, String, Hashtable) | 0% | 0% | 5 | 5 | 15 | 15 | 1 | 1 | ||
| parseContentspec(String) | 0% | 0% | 4 | 4 | 16 | 16 | 1 | 1 | ||
| setAttribute(String, String, int, String, String, int) | 0% | 0% | 3 | 3 | 14 | 14 | 1 | 1 | ||
| error(String, String, String) | 0% | 0% | 4 | 4 | 9 | 9 | 1 | 1 | ||
| parseDefault(String, String, int, String) | 0% | 0% | 5 | 5 | 16 | 16 | 1 | 1 | ||
| copyIso8859_1ReadBuffer(int, char) | 0% | 0% | 4 | 4 | 9 | 9 | 1 | 1 | ||
| setEntity(String, int, String, String, String, String) | 0% | 0% | 3 | 3 | 10 | 10 | 1 | 1 | ||
| parseTextDecl(boolean) | 0% | 0% | 4 | 4 | 16 | 16 | 1 | 1 | ||
| isExtender(char) | 0% | 0% | 15 | 15 | 1 | 1 | 1 | 1 | ||
| extendArray(Object, int, int) | 0% | 0% | 5 | 5 | 13 | 13 | 1 | 1 | ||
| unread(char[], int) | 0% | 0% | 4 | 4 | 9 | 9 | 1 | 1 | ||
| parseMixed() | 0% | 0% | 3 | 3 | 14 | 14 | 1 | 1 | ||
| parseNotationDecl() | 0% | 0% | 3 | 3 | 10 | 10 | 1 | 1 | ||
| read8bitEncodingDeclaration() | 0% | 0% | 4 | 4 | 9 | 9 | 1 | 1 | ||
| encodingError(String, int, int) | 0% | 0% | 3 | 3 | 7 | 7 | 1 | 1 | ||
| getEntitySystemId(String) | 0% | 0% | 3 | 3 | 9 | 9 | 1 | 1 | ||
| parsePI() | 0% | 0% | 3 | 3 | 11 | 11 | 1 | 1 | ||
| parseEnumeration(boolean) | 0% | 0% | 2 | 2 | 12 | 12 | 1 | 1 | ||
| getNextUtf8Byte(int, int) | 0% | 0% | 4 | 4 | 8 | 8 | 1 | 1 | ||
| cleanupVariables() | 0% | n/a | 1 | 1 | 13 | 13 | 1 | 1 | ||
| readAttType() | 0% | 0% | 4 | 4 | 11 | 11 | 1 | 1 | ||
| unread(char) | 0% | 0% | 3 | 3 | 7 | 7 | 1 | 1 | ||
| tryRead(String) | 0% | 0% | 4 | 4 | 9 | 9 | 1 | 1 | ||
| parseUntil(String) | 0% | 0% | 2 | 2 | 7 | 7 | 1 | 1 | ||
| dataBufferAppend(char)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| tryEncodingDecl(boolean) | 0% | 0% | 4 | 4 | 9 | 9 | 1 | 1 | ||
| parseDocument() | 0% | n/a | 1 | 1 | 11 | 11 | 1 | 1 | ||
| parseAttDef(String) | 0% | 0% | 3 | 3 | 9 | 9 | 1 | 1 | ||
| dataBufferAppend(char[], int, int) | 0% | n/a | 1 | 1 | 4 | 4 | 1 | 1 | ||
| parseComment() | 0% | n/a | 1 | 1 | 8 | 8 | 1 | 1 | ||
| parseCp() | 0% | 0% | 3 | 3 | 10 | 10 | 1 | 1 | ||
| parseAttlistDecl() | 0% | 0% | 3 | 3 | 9 | 9 | 1 | 1 | ||
| require(char, String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| tryEncoding(byte[], byte, byte, byte, byte) | 0% | 0% | 5 | 5 | 1 | 1 | 1 | 1 | ||
| setNotation(String, String, String) | 0% | 0% | 2 | 2 | 6 | 6 | 1 | 1 | ||
| isWhitespace(char) | 0% | 0% | 6 | 6 | 5 | 5 | 1 | 1 | ||
| tryEncoding(byte[], byte, byte, byte) | 0% | 0% | 4 | 4 | 1 | 1 | 1 | 1 | ||
| pushCharArray(String, char[], int, int) | 0% | n/a | 1 | 1 | 7 | 7 | 1 | 1 | ||
| parseMisc() | 0% | 0% | 3 | 3 | 7 | 7 | 1 | 1 | ||
| parseElementdecl() | 0% | n/a | 1 | 1 | 7 | 7 | 1 | 1 | ||
| parseWhitespace() | 0% | 0% | 2 | 2 | 6 | 6 | 1 | 1 | ||
| parseETag() | 0% | n/a | 1 | 1 | 5 | 5 | 1 | 1 | ||
| requireWhitespace() | 0% | 0% | 2 | 2 | 5 | 5 | 1 | 1 | ||
| getContentType(Object[], int) | 0% | 0% | 3 | 3 | 6 | 6 | 1 | 1 | ||
| declaredAttributes(Object[]) | 0% | 0% | 3 | 3 | 5 | 5 | 1 | 1 | ||
| getEntityType(String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| tryWhitespace() | 0% | 0% | 2 | 2 | 6 | 6 | 1 | 1 | ||
| getElementContentModel(String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getElementAttributes(String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getAttributeType(String, String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getAttributeDefaultValueType(String, String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getEntityPublicId(String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getEntityValue(String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getEntityNotationName(String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getNotationPublicId(String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getNotationSystemId(String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| dataBufferToString() | 0% | n/a | 1 | 1 | 3 | 3 | 1 | 1 | ||
| getAttributeEnumeration(String, String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| getAttributeDefaultValue(String, String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| tryEncoding(byte[], byte, byte) | 0% | 0% | 3 | 3 | 1 | 1 | 1 | 1 | ||
| getAttribute(String, String) | 0% | 0% | 2 | 2 | 4 | 4 | 1 | 1 | ||
| tryRead(char) | 0% | 0% | 2 | 2 | 5 | 5 | 1 | 1 | ||
| parseProlog() | 0% | 0% | 2 | 2 | 5 | 5 | 1 | 1 | ||
| getElementContentType(String) | 0% | n/a | 1 | 1 | 2 | 2 | 1 | 1 | ||
| pushString(String, String) | 0% | n/a | 1 | 1 | 3 | 3 | 1 | 1 | ||
| error(String, char, String) | 0% | n/a | 1 | 1 | 2 | 2 | 1 | 1 | ||
| parseNotationType() | 0% | n/a | 1 | 1 | 4 | 4 | 1 | 1 | ||
| parseEq() | 0% | n/a | 1 | 1 | 4 | 4 | 1 | 1 | ||
| setInternalEntity(String, String) | 0% | n/a | 1 | 1 | 2 | 2 | 1 | 1 | ||
| setExternalDataEntity(String, String, String, String) | 0% | n/a | 1 | 1 | 2 | 2 | 1 | 1 | ||
| setExternalTextEntity(String, String, String) | 0% | n/a | 1 | 1 | 2 | 2 | 1 | 1 | ||
| dataBufferAppend(String) | 0% | n/a | 1 | 1 | 2 | 2 | 1 | 1 | ||
| declaredAttributes(String) | 0% | n/a | 1 | 1 | 1 | 1 | 1 | 1 | ||
| error(String) | 0% | n/a | 1 | 1 | 2 | 2 | 1 | 1 | ||
| parseCDSect() | 0% | n/a | 1 | 1 | 3 | 3 | 1 | 1 | ||
| XmlParser() | 0% | n/a | 1 | 1 | 3 | 3 | 1 | 1 | ||
| setHandler(SAXDriver) | 0% | n/a | 1 | 1 | 2 | 2 | 1 | 1 | ||
| declaredElements() | 0% | n/a | 1 | 1 | 1 | 1 | 1 | 1 | ||
| declaredEntities() | 0% | n/a | 1 | 1 | 1 | 1 | 1 | 1 | ||
| declaredNotations() | 0% | n/a | 1 | 1 | 1 | 1 | 1 | 1 | ||
| getLineNumber() | 0% | n/a | 1 | 1 | 1 | 1 | 1 | 1 | ||
| getColumnNumber() | 0% | n/a | 1 | 1 | 1 | 1 | 1 | 1 |